Wash and cube the potatoes, then toss them with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Spread them on a baking sheet and roast for about 25-30 minutes, or until crispy.
In a skillet over medium heat, brown the ground meat. Once cooked, add taco seasoning and mix well.
In a large bowl, combine the roasted potatoes, seasoned meat, black beans, corn, and diced bell pepper.
Serve the mixture in bowls, topped with cheese, avocado, and optional sour cream.
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ving. Enjoy your hearty Loaded Potato Taco Bowl!
Notes
For a crunchier texture, broil the potato cubes for a minute at the end of roasting, but watch closely.
